Output 50520980ac6c40be74d11f5c12cb89211053f650af9a98dbd79fe7af7f2fe43d:0

value
3014659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01ebb80ed4c66899dffc309c51120fb42f4e5f81 OP_EQUAL
address
31sAyn2hdxys7wAe1erFur9aMtFbk74YHY
transaction
50520980ac6c40be74d11f5c12cb89211053f650af9a98dbd79fe7af7f2fe43d
spent
true